Midscene.js 安装与配置指南

Midscene.js 安装与配置指南

midscene Let AI be your browser operator. midscene 项目地址: https://gitcode.com/gh_mirrors/mid/midscene

1. 项目基础介绍

Midscene.js 是一个开源项目,旨在通过 AI 驱动浏览器自动化操作。用户可以使用自然语言描述任务需求,Midscene.js 将自动执行相应的浏览器操作,如数据提取、页面验证等。该项目是一个完全开源的工具,适用于自动化测试、数据抓取等多种场景。

主要编程语言:TypeScript

2. 关键技术和框架

  • AI 模型: Midscene.js 使用了多种 AI 模型,包括 GPT-4o、UI-TARS 和 Qwen2.5-VL 等,这些模型用于理解和执行用户的自然语言指令。
  • 浏览器自动化: 通过集成 Puppeteer 和 Playwright,Midscene.js 可以执行复杂的浏览器自动化任务。
  • Chrome 插件: 提供了 Chrome 插件,使得用户无需编写代码即可体验浏览器自动化。
  • YAML 配置: 用户可以通过编写 YAML 文件来定义自动化脚本,而无需编写 JavaScript 代码。

3. 安装和配置准备工作

在开始安装之前,请确保您的系统中已经安装了以下工具:

  • Node.js: Midscene.js 依赖于 Node.js 环境,请确保安装了 Node.js 和 npm。
  • Git: 用于克隆和更新项目代码。

安装步骤

  1. 克隆项目到本地目录:

    git clone https://github.com/web-infra-dev/midscene.git
    cd midscene
    
  2. 安装项目依赖:

    npm install
    
  3. 配置项目(如果需要):

    根据项目需求,可能需要配置环境变量或修改配置文件。查看项目文档以获取更多配置信息。

  4. 运行项目:

    npm run start
    

    这将启动 Midscene.js 服务,你可以通过浏览器访问它。

注意事项

  • 确保在执行 npm install 命令时,您位于项目根目录。
  • 如果您打算使用 Chrome 插件,请确保已经安装了 Chrome 浏览器,并按照项目文档中的指示进行操作。

通过上述步骤,您应该能够成功安装和配置 Midscene.js 项目,并开始使用它来执行浏览器自动化任务。

midscene Let AI be your browser operator. midscene 项目地址: https://gitcode.com/gh_mirrors/mid/midscene

### Midscene.js 部署指南 #### 1. 准备工作环境 为了成功部署Midscene.js应用,确保开发环境中已安装Node.js和npm。可以通过以下命令验证版本: ```bash node -v npm -v ``` 如果尚未安装这些工具,请访问官方文档获取最新安装指导[^5]。 #### 2. 获取项目源码 从GitHub仓库克隆Midscene.js项目的最新稳定版至本地机器: ```bash git clone https://github.com/midscenews/midscene.git cd midscene ``` 此操作会下载整个项目结构及其依赖项文件`package.json`[^6]。 #### 3. 安装依赖包 进入项目根目录并执行NPM install来加载所有必要的库和支持模块: ```bash npm install ``` 这一步骤将读取`package.json`中的定义,并自动处理所有的外部依赖关系[^7]。 #### 4. 构建生产版本 对于正式上线前准备,建议构建优化后的前端资源。运行下面的脚本来完成编译过程: ```bash npm run build ``` 该指令将会依据配置生成适合线上使用的静态资产,在默认情况下位于`dist/`文件夹内[^8]。 #### 5. 设置服务器端支持 根据具体需求选择合适的Web服务器托管方式。可以考虑使用Express框架快速搭建一个简单的HTTP服务作为API网关或代理层;也可以直接利用像Apache/Nginx这样的成熟解决方案来进行反向代理设置[^9]。 #### 6. 发布到目标平台 最后一步就是把打包好的应用程序上传至选定的目标平台上发布出去。如果是云服务商的话,则按照其提供的指引进行相应的调整配置即可[^10]。
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包

打赏作者

孙爽知Kody

你的鼓励将是我创作的最大动力

¥1 ¥2 ¥4 ¥6 ¥10 ¥20
扫码支付:¥1
获取中
扫码支付

您的余额不足,请更换扫码支付或充值

打赏作者

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值